    Understanding How Salt-Free Water Softeners Work

    While traditional water softeners have relied on salt to combat hard water for decades, salt-free water softeners offer a revolutionary alternative that's gaining popularity among eco-conscious homeowners.

    first image

    We love how these innovative water treatment solutions work through processes like Template Assisted Crystallization (TAC) and Nucleation Assisted Crystallization (NAC).

    Unlike their salt-based counterparts, these systems don't actually remove hardness minerals from your water. Instead, they cleverly transform calcium and magnesium crystals into a form that won't stick to your pipes and appliances.

    The magic of salt-free systems lies in transformation, not elimination—keeping minerals while preventing their problematic buildup.

    TAC systems create suspended crystals that flow harmlessly through your plumbing, while NAC systems actively prevent scale and even remove existing buildup.

    They're environmentally friendly with no wastewater production, preserve beneficial minerals, and greatly reduce maintenance costs—no more lugging heavy salt bags home!

    Top-Rated Salt-Free Water Softener Systems for 2025

    Now that we comprehend how salt-free softeners transform hard water without chemicals, let's look at the best systems available this year.

    The SpringWell Futuresoft stands as our top pick, utilizing Template Assisted Crystallization to handle an impressive 81 GPG maximum hardness with 20 GPM flow rate—perfect for larger homes.

    For multi-bathroom households, the Kind E-2000 delivers excellent water conditioning with its 75 GPG capacity and 15 GPM flow rate.

    The SoftPro Elite offers a compelling alternative with its NAC technology providing effective scale prevention for homes with up to five bedrooms.

    Meanwhile, the US Water Systems GreenWave impresses with 97% conditioning efficiency and size options supporting flow rates from 10-25 GPM.

    With prices ranging from $1,263 to $1,597, these systems cater to diverse household needs while eliminating salt dependency.

    Maintenance Requirements & Long-Term Cost Analysis

    When comparing salt-free water softeners to traditional systems, maintenance requirements and long-term costs stand out as major advantages. Unlike traditional salt-based systems that demand regular salt refills and monitoring, salt-free water softeners like the SpringWell FutureSoft and Kind E-2000 require minimal attention.

    Salt-free water softeners offer dramatically lower maintenance demands than their traditional counterparts, saving time and ongoing costs.

    We've found that annual maintenance typically involves just changing sediment filter replacements, costing about $40-$60 yearly. Compare this to the ongoing expenses of salt-based alternatives, and the savings become clear.

    Many systems, such as the US Water Systems GreenWave, even offer lifetime warranties, eliminating worries about future replacement costs.

    The benefits extend beyond direct operating costs too. Your appliances will enjoy greater longevity without scale buildup, and you'll avoid generating salty wastewater.

    Do Saltless Water Softeners Actually Work?

    Yes, saltless water softeners do work, but differently. We've found they prevent scale buildup rather than removing minerals. They're effective at crystal formation, though they won't give you that traditional "soft water feel."

    What Are the Disadvantages of Salt-Free Water Softeners?

    We've found salt-free softeners don't actually remove hard minerals, just crystallize them. They're pricier upfront, deliver inconsistent results depending on your water chemistry, and won't give you that slippery, softened feel.
